5.10 USB Configuration (Advanced → USB Configuration)

Legacy USB Support: It is recommended to enable the USB keyboard/mouse for use during DOS or BIOS phases.

XHCI Hand Off: If the operating system does not support XHCI, it needs to be enabled (usually left as default).

USB Mass Storage Driver Support: When enabled, it can recognize USB drives in the BIOS.

5.11 Chipset Menu

5.11.1 System Agent Configuration

Graphics Configuration:

Primary Display: Optional Auto/IGFX/PEG/PCI, deciding to prioritize the use of integrated graphics cards, PCIe graphics cards, or PCI graphics cards during startup.

Internal Graphics:Auto/Enable/Disable, If installing a dedicated graphics card, it can be set to Disable to free up memory, but if multi screen output is required, keep it enabled.

DVMT Pre Located: It is recommended to allocate at least 64MB of video memory for integrated graphics.

DVMT Total Gfx Mem: Maximum available video memory, optional 256M/128M/MAX.

PEG Port Configuration: Set the link speed (Auto/Gen1/Gen2/Gen3) and detect non compatible devices for PCIe x16 slots.

5.11.2 PCH-IO Configuration

PCI Express Configuration:

LAN1/LAN2 Controller: can independently enable or disable dual network cards, and can enable the PCIe Option ROM.

Wake on Lan: If network wake-up is required, set it to Enabled.

Restore AC Power Loss: Behavior after power failure recovery - [Power On] automatically turns on, [Power Off] remains turned off, [Last State] restores the state before power failure. Power On is commonly used in industrial sites.

GPIO Group Control: Each GPIO pin can be individually set to input or output high/low (through GPIO 1 Control~GPIO 32 Control) to facilitate the initialization of IO status during system startup.

SATA Configuration:

SATA Controller(s):Enabled。

SATA Mode: Optional AHCI (recommended) or Intel RST Premium (supports RAID).

SATA Controller Speed: Default (auto negotiate Gen3), can also force Gen1/Gen2 to be compatible with older hard drives.

Each port can be individually enabled/disabled and display information about connected devices.

USB Configuration:

XHCI Disable Compliance Mode: Generally remains False.

USB Port Disable Override: Specific physical ports (HS/SS) can be disabled for secure isolation.

HD Audio Configuration: Control the audio controller to enable/disable.

Serial IO Configuration: This board supports I2C0 and GPIO controllers, and can enable/disable and set I2C voltage (1.8V/3.3V) and clock speed (for onboard I2C bus).

5.12 Security Menu

Administrator/user password can be set and Secure Boot can be enabled (CSM needs to be turned off).

5.13 Boot Menu

Boot mode select:LEGACY/UEFI, Affects the type of startup device.

Fixed Boot Order Priorities: Priority order can be set by device type (hard drive, optical drive, USB, network).

Supports EFI Shell startup.

5.14 Save and Exit

Provide functions such as saving/discarding changes, restoring default values, and boot overwrite (such as booting from a USB drive).

System resource and interrupt allocation

6.1 Memory Mapping

The traditional ISA area (15MB~16MB) is reserved, the high BIOS area is located at the top of 4GB, and the APIC configuration space is in FEC00000~FECFFFFF, etc.

6.2 I/O Address

COM1~COM6 occupy standard address (3F8/2F8/3E8/2E8/2E0/3E0) and IRQ (4/3/5/6/10/11) respectively, which can be adjusted by the user in BIOS.

LPT1 defaults to 378h/IRQ7.

SATA controller occupies F080h, SMBus address E000h, etc.

6.3 IRQ Allocation (APIC Mode)

Interruptions 16-19 are shared by PCIe root ports, HD Audio, SATA, etc., as detailed in Table 8 of the manual. When installing a PCI card, if there is a resource conflict, you can try changing the PCI slot because the interrupt routing for different slots is different.

6.4 PCI Configuration Space and Routing

Built in devices such as graphics cards, USB xHCI, SATA controllers, dual network cards, etc. all have fixed bus/device numbers. The PCIe to PCI bridge (ITE8892) connects the PCI slot, and interrupts in the PCI slot can be adjusted through BIOS (if available).

6.5 SMBus Address

The SPDs of DIMM A/B respond to A0h and A4h respectively, and can be used for memory information reading.


Driver installation and operating system support

Official support for Windows 7 (only 6th generation) CPU)、Windows 8.1 64-bit、Windows 10 64-bit、OpenSUSE Leap 42.1、Fedora 25、Ubuntu 16.04 LTS 64-bit。 Drivers can be downloaded from the official website product page, including chipset, graphics card (integrated HD Graphics), network card (I219-LM/I211-AT), audio (ALC892), SATA (Intel RST), GPIO, etc.

Installation points:

For Windows 7, as the H110 chipset does not natively support USB 3.0, it is necessary to inject USB 3.0 drivers into the installation image or use a PS/2 keyboard and mouse.

If using Intel RST RAID mode, the F6 driver needs to be loaded during installation (a USB flash drive can be used).

GPIO and serial communication may require the installation of the Super IO driver (NCT6106D) to use advanced features.
